The Message

Album: Cuatro (1992)
Play Video

Songfacts®:

  • This is a track from Cuatro, Flotsam and Jetsam's fourth album. The LP title means 'four' in Spanish.
  • The song was co-written by Chris Cornell. Guitarist Michael Gilbert told us in a 2013 interview that the idea was sent over to the Soundgarden vocalist with the music already written. "We never even got together," he recalled, "we didn't even speak to each other about it. I thought it was great for what was going on. That guy is another great lyricist. It just gives me chills because the guy is so on top of it, and conveyed at least his message to me really clear and in a way that is inspiring for me."
